Albright Named MAC East Defensive Player of the Week
11/23/2015 12:00:00 AM | Football
Nov. 23, 2015

Bryson Albright, a member of the Miami University football team, was named Mid-American Conference East Division Defensive Player of the Week, following the contest versus UMass. The announcement was made by the league office on Monday morning.
Playing in his final game as a RedHawk, the fifth-year senior recorded seven tackles, 2.0 sacks, 2.5 tackles for loss and a game-clinching interception in a 20-13 win over the Minutemen. His first career interception came on a fourth down from the Miami 17-yard line as UMass threatened to tie the game. Albright was also part of a defensive effort that allowed just 250 total yards to UMass' high powered offense.
